The
Secretary of War was a member of the
President's Cabinet since Washington's administration. At first, he was responsible for all military affairs. In
1798, the
Secretary of the Navy was added to the cabinet, and the scope of this office was reduced to a general concern with the Army. In
1947, the departments were recombined under the
Secretary of Defense. The Secretary of War was replaced by the
Secretary of the Army[?], a non-Cabinet position under the
Secretary of Defense.
